Today, when big screen smartphones are in the world, at that time a small screen Android phone has been launched. The name of this phone is Palm and its size is equivalent to ATM Card. This phone has a 3.3-inch display only. At present, this phone has been launched in the US, where it costs $ 349 (about 25 thousand rupees).

Can connect with other phones also

The special thing about Palm Phone is that it can be connected to any other Android or iOS device. However, this feature is still in the US only.

Actually, American telecom company Verizon is offering its ‘number sharing’ service, which can connect any Android or iPhone to a Palm phone. After that both incoming calls and messages will come on the phone.

Face Unlock for Security

The Palm phone has 12 megapixels on the rear and 8 megapixel camera on the front. Which supports Face Unlock feature.

In addition, this phone comes with IP68 rating, which means that this phone is waterproof and dust proof.

Specification of Palm phone

 

Display 3.3 Inch
Processor  Snapdragon435
RAM 3 gb
Storage 32 gb
Front camera 8 mp
Rear camera 12 mp
Battery 800mAh
Security Face unloack
Os Android 8.1
Connectivity 4G LTE, wifi , bluetooth
